Output f53deb4def74baa27096815025522a7673efc9fb7889ae9e346bc4fc04224da9:1

value
23953063
script pubkey
OP_0 OP_PUSHBYTES_20 e2bdcdb161107c310a7b31b9067274c18001ba49
address
ltc1qu27umvtpzp7rzznmxxusvun5cxqqrwjfjdm42f
transaction
f53deb4def74baa27096815025522a7673efc9fb7889ae9e346bc4fc04224da9
spent
true